Web2. something resembling this structure, either because of being round and hard or because of being considered valuable. 3. a small medicated granule, or a glass globule with a … WebPearl barley, or pearled barley, is barley that has been processed to remove its fibrous outer hull and polished to remove some or all of the bran layer. [1] It is the most common form …
